Up close: Die Tierklinik is a German television documentary from the small animal clinics in Lüneburg (first and sometimes also second season) and Wasbek (second season), which has been broadcast on VOX since September 2016 . The clinic in Wasbek is a family business of the Frahm family.

In addition to treating animal emergencies, the vets also have to assist the troubled keepers. Numerous employees take care of the animals and their owners. The viewer follows the action via permanently installed cameras.
